PARSOL
DESCRIPTION
PARSOL is a body-tinted glass, manufactured in the same way as PLANICLEAR clear float glass. PARSOL has a coloured appearance, as well as basic solar control properties.
PRODUCT APPLICATION
PARSOL, like PLANICLEAR, is intended for universal applications where an attractive appearance or basic solar control properties are required:
- Interior applications for decoration, fittings and furniture
- External applications in single or double-glazing, for facades and overhead glazing
RANGE
There are 5 colours in the PARSOL range:
- PARSOL GREEN
- PARSOL BRONZE
- PARSOL GREY
- PARSOL DARK GREY
- PARSOL ULTRA GREY
- PARSOL SAPHIRE BLUE
PARSOL products are available in a range of thicknesses, from 3 mm to 12 mm, depending on the colour.
PERFORMANCE
The spectrophotometric performance of the most commonly used PARSOL references are given for:
- Single glazing
- In double-glazed units combined with PLANICLEAR
- In enhanced thermal insulation double-glazed units with PLANITHERM TOTAL low-emissivity glass. The mechanical and acoustic performances are the same as a standard PLANICLEAR glass of the same thickness
PARSOL: Single-glazing | |||||
Colour | Bronze | Green | |||
Thickness mm | 4 | 5 | 6 | 5 | 6 |
Light factors | |||||
LT % | 60 | 54 | 49 | 77 | 74 |
LRe % | 6 | 6 | 5 | 7 | 7 |
LRi % | 6 | 6 | 5 | 7 | 7 |
Energy factors | |||||
T % | 61 | 55 | 50 | 54 | 49 |
Re % | 6 | 6 | 5 | 6 | 6 |
Ri % | 6 | 6 | 5 | 6 | 6 |
A % | 33 | 39 | 45 | 40 | 45 |
Solar factor g | 0.69 | 0.65 | 0.61 | 0.64 | 0.61 |
Shading coefficient SC | 0.80 | 0.75 | 0.70 | 0.74 | 0.70 |
U-value W/(m2.K) | 5.8 | 5.8 | 5.7 | 5.8 | 5.7 |
PARSOL: Single-glazing | ||||||
Colour | Grey | Dark Grey | Blue | |||
Thickness mm | 5 | 6 | 5 | 6 | 5 | 6 |
Light factors | ||||||
LT % | 49 | 43 | 19 | 14 | 62 | 57 |
LRe % | 5 | 5 | 4 | 4 | 6 | 6 |
LRi % | 5 | 5 | 4 | 4 | 6 | 6 |
Energy factors | ||||||
T % | 51 | 46 | 32 | 27 | 49 | 44 |
Re % | 6 | 5 | 5 | 5 | 5 | 5 |
Ri % | 6 | 5 | 5 | 5 | 5 | 5 |
A % | 43 | 49 | 63 | 69 | 46 | 51 |
Solar factor g | 0.63 | 0.59 | 0.48 | 0.44 | 0.61 | 0.57 |
Shading coefficient SC | 0.72 | 0.67 | 0.56 | 0.51 | 0.70 | 0.65 |
U-value W/(m2.K) | 5.8 | 5.7 | 5.8 | 5.7 | 5.8 | 5.7 |
GUIDELINE
The installation possibilities and recommendations for PARSOL are the same as standard clear glass. Depending on the application or location, PARSOL may require heat treatment to avoid the risk of thermal breakage.

STANDARDS AND REGULATION
PARSOL body-tinted glass conforms to standard BS EN 572-2 and carries the relevant CE mark as required.
PROCESSING CAPABILITIES
PARSOL can undergo the same processes as PLANICLEAR and is the base glass for many other processed products: coated glass, laminated glass, toughened, screen-printed, decorated, acid-etched, sandblasted, lacquered, edgeworked and silvered glass, as well as double-glazed units etc.
